If an assisted family vacates a dwelling unit for which rental assistance is provided under a housing assistance payment contract before the expiration of the term of the lease for the unit, rental assistance pursuant to such contract may not be provided for the unit after the month during which the unit was vacated.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- New York Consolidated Laws, Public Housing Law - PBG § 615. Vacated units - last updated January 01, 2026 | https://codes.findlaw.com/ny/public-housing-law/pbg-sect-615/
